RHOADS, David Austin, born June 9, 1980, departed this life on February 11, 2013, at VCU Medical Center in Richmond, Va. David goes to join his beloved grandfather, Edwin Rhoads Jr.; and grandmother, Mary Elizabeth Rhoads; his great-grandmother, Lillian Evans and his great-grandfather, Dave R. Evans. David leaves behind his loving father and mother, Gene and Bonnie Rhoads; also his faithful, loving 14-year-old black lab girl, Candy. He is also survived by his Aunt Carole Rike and husband, Jim Rike; uncle, Larry Rhoads and wife, Brenda, Aunt Judy Roberts and husband, Tracy; great-uncle, Richard Newsome and friend, Starla; his many cousins and family members; his many new friends and VCU staff whose lives were changed by David's love. He also leaves behind very special friends, Dr. Wayne LeGrow and wife, Marilyn, Victoria Powell, Bell Sadler, H. Lee Townsend and wife, Vicky, Pam Allen and husband, Cecil Jr., Reggie Ferguson and wife, Kari, Anthony Bowser and wife, Tangela, Patricia Helen Hicks, Dennis Allen and wife, Cecilia; care giver, Debbie Whiting, Michael Otten, and Wilson Clary and wife, Pat. A memorial service will be held on Saturday, 1 p.m., at Word of Life Assembly of God Church, located at 707 Brunswick Avenue, Emporia, Va., and will be officiated by Pastor Gary Moorehouse.
